About 41 The Hopmarket
41 The Hopmarket is an end-of-terrace house in Worcester (WR1 1DD). It has a recorded floor area of 49 m² (around 527 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1900-1929 and council tax band A. At 49 m² this is the 20th smallest of 38 units on EPC record in the building, where floor areas span 24–96 m². The building's EPC ratings span F to C, with this unit at the top. The latest certificate (August 2020) shows a C (score 70).

No sales recorded with HM Land Registry
That can mean the property has never traded since the registry began publishing in 1995, was a new build that hasn't been registered yet, or is held in the same hands long-term.
